AI Engineer(Junior Level)

Xiaomi
Singapore, SG
On-site

Job Description

Job description:

  • Support the development and optimization of search relevance and ranking on the Mi.com platform
  • Implement and maintain components of the search pipeline, including data processing, feature engineering, and model integration
  • Develop data pipelines to process large-scale structured and unstructured data (e.g., query logs, product data)
  • Apply basic machine learning and NLP techniques to improve query understanding and search relevance
  • Assist in implementing embedding-based retrieval and semantic matching models
  • Support offline evaluation and online experiments (e.g., A/B testing) to measure model performance
  • Collaborate with senior engineers, product managers, and data analysts to deliver search improvements

Requirement:

  • Proficiency in Java
  • Basic understanding of search systems (e.g., indexing, retrieval, ranking)
  • Familiarity with NLP techniques such as text processing, tokenization, and basic semantic matching
  • Experience with Elasticsearch is a plus
  • Good communication and teamwork skills. Ability to communicate in Mandarin and English, in order to support coordination and collaboration with Mandarin-speaking stakeholders, teams, and business partners across regional markets.

Skills & Requirements

Technical Skills

JavaSearch systemsIndexingRetrievalRankingNlp techniquesText processingTokenizationSemantic matchingElasticsearchMachine learningNlpEmbedding-based retrievalSemantic matching modelsOffline evaluationOnline experimentsA/b testingModel performanceCommunicationTeamworkCollaborationAiSearchMachine learningNlpData processingFeature engineeringModel integrationData pipelinesQuery understandingSearch relevanceEmbedding-based retrievalSemantic matchingOffline evaluationOnline experimentsA/b testingModel performance

Employment Type

FULL TIME

Level

junior

Posted

5/8/2026

Apply Now

You will be redirected to Xiaomi's application portal.

Sign in and we'll score your resume against this role.

Find Similar Jobs

Browse roles in the same category, level, and remote setup.

Sign in to open the target role workbench.